Omkostningerne ved at udvikle en app som Airbnb

Air Bed and Breakfast er en af de førende formidlere af ferieudlejningsydelser med en mere end 20% markedsandel af branchen. Det giver folk et anstændigt alternativ til nogle gange overvældende dyre hoteller, samtidig med at det er en kilde til sekundær (eller nogle gange endda primær) indkomst for andre.Korte tal: mere end 4 millioner Værter i over 100.000 byer verden over har mere end 6 millioner opslag. Applikationen betjener 150 millioner mennesker over hele verden, hvilket giver hver vært en gennemsnitlig årlig indkomst på 13.800 dollars.En robust og pålidelig app som Airbnb kan være dyr at skabe. Der er stigende efterspørgsel efter lokale produkter, og de skal opfylde høje standarder for funktionalitet, sikkerhed og brugeroplevelse for at kunne matche deres veletablerede konkurrenter. At opbygge et sådant produkt indebærer en ret betydelig investering i ressourcer - både økonomisk og teknologisk. Det er muligt at estimere omkostningerne ved at udvikle en app som Airbnb gennem analyse af estimater for udviklingsarbejde, valg af teknologi og forståelse af de ekstra lag af kompleksitet inden for kvalitetssikringstest af produktet. Alle disse elementer er nødvendige for at kunne bygge en app, der kan konkurrere med markedsgiganter som Airbnb.Lad os se, hvad du skal bruge udvikle en app som Airbnb og hvor meget det vil koste.

Om Airbnb

Vi har allerede nævnt de rå tal ovenfor. Men lad os se, hvad der er under motorhjelmen, som har ført Airbnb til en så overvældende succes.

Generelt kan vi sige, at det er en peer-to-peer-markedsplads for udlejning af boliger, der drives af web- og mobilapplikationer. Alt, hvor brugerne kan blive indkvarteret, fra et værelse i forstaden til en yacht, kan ses der.

Hvis vi ser på forretningsmodellen, er Airbnb et mellemled mellem dem, der har ledige lejligheder i kort tid, og dem, der ønsker at bo et andet sted end på hoteller. Som mellemmand kan sådanne virksomheder tjene på både værts- og gæsteservicegebyrer. Det er muligt, uden at det er nødvendigt at eje noget boligområde overhovedet, da indkvartering leveres af brugerne.

Konkurrenter

Mens Airbnb er et populært valg for rejsende, der er på udkig efter et billigt og komfortabelt ophold, er der flere konkurrenter, der tilbyder et alternativ. For eksempel Airbnb, Expedia tilbyder ferieboliger ud over deres hotelbookinger, og homestay.com tilbyder tjenester til budgetrejsende med værter, der åbner deres hjem for gæster. Booking.com har også en række muligheder, som f.eks. lejligheder og villaer. Virksomheder som FlipKey har tilpassede prisplaner, der giver ejere mulighed for at justere natpriserne, mens de stadig nyder godt af sikre betalinger og kundeservicesupport. Alle disse konkurrerende tjenester tilbyder en grad af variation og bekvemmelighed, der kan sammenlignes med Airbnbs platform, så kunderne kan finde et sted, der opfylder deres behov, når de rejser i udlandet.

udvikle en app som Airbnb

Funktioner

Med hensyn til Airbnb-funktioner ligner stort set alle app'er til boligreservation hinanden, da sådanne store virksomheder er trendsættere, når det gælder funktionalitet og brugergrænseflade.

Så lad os se, hvilke funktioner sådanne produkter normalt har.

Kernefunktioner

Tilmeld dig/login

Når man går ind i applikationen for første gang, skal man oprette en konto.

Normalt giver denne funktion brugerne de nødvendige oplysninger som vilkår og betingelser, der skal accepteres for at fortsætte. Der bør også være en populær mulighed for at oprette en konto via populære sociale mediekonti.

Brugerne skal indtaste deres kontooplysninger eller bruge deres sociale medier til at logge ind ved efterfølgende interaktioner med applikationen.

For at øge brugersikkerheden anbefaler vi at tilføje funktioner som to-faktor-autentificering, nulstilling af adgangskode og udlogning på alle enheder.

Profil

Både besøgende og værter har brug for profiler for at kunne interagere med hinanden. Disse profiler skal have en avatar, en beskrivelse, kontaktoplysninger og skjulte personlige oplysninger som betalingsoplysninger, køn og fødselsdato.

Søg efter

Søgemaskinen er den funktion, som brugerne oftest vil interagere med. Derfor skal den være brugervenlig og alsidig.

Den bør have en lang række filtre for at få mere præcise resultater. Dette omfatter land, by og ønskede tilgængelighedsdatoer. Sådanne produkter kan også have gavn af at introducere maskinlæringsløsninger som anbefalingssystemer. Ved at bruge sådanne værktøjer kan rejseapps give mere personlige resultater til hver enkelt person.

Liste over virksomheder

Annoncer er en slags produktkort, som værterne laver. De repræsenterer den lejlighed, de udlåner, og indeholder oplysninger som en detaljeret beskrivelse, adresse, pris for en nat, billeder af lejligheden osv.

Favoritter

Favoritter giver brugerne mulighed for hurtigt at finde deres foretrukne overnatningssteder ved at tilføje dem til en separat side.

udvikle en app som Airbnb

Chat

En chat mellem en besøgende og en vært er et værktøj, der gør det muligt at afklare forskellige nuancer, der ikke er beskrevet i annoncen.

Desuden skal brugerne kunne sende og modtage mediefiler, hvis der opstår spørgsmål om lejligheden.

Anmeldelser

Brugerne skal kunne give feedback om den pågældende bolig eller vært. Den mest almindelige måde at implementere denne funktion på er ved at give en karakter på 1 til 5 stjerner med valgfri tekstbaggrund.

Betalingssystem

Den mest pålidelige form for booking er at betale på forhånd. Til dette formål skal appen kunne behandle onlinebetalinger.

Noget ekstra

For at tilføje lidt ekstra smag og komfort for brugerne har sådanne produkter nogle gange følgende funktioner, der ledsager kernefunktionerne:

  • Push-meddelelser for rettidige opdateringer om indkvartering og betalingsstatus, nye indgående beskeder og meddelelser.
  • Vejrudsigt for målstedet kan give en fremragende brugeroplevelse ved at hjælpe med at vælge det rigtige tøj.
  • Valutaomregner vil give besøgende mulighed for at se, hvor meget den udenlandske lejlighed vil koste i deres nationale valuta.
  • Indbygget oversætter vil udviske sprogbarrieren mellem den besøgende og værten fra forskellige lande.
  • Navigation i appen vil give besøgende mulighed for at finde den bedste rute til deres opholdssted uden at skulle skifte til kort.
  • Loyalitetsprogrammer vil tiltrække nye brugere og fastholde de eksisterende, samtidig med at de opfordres til at bruge dit produkt oftere.
  • Integration af tredjepartstjenester vil gøre brugernes rejser endnu mere behagelige. Sådanne produkter kan samarbejde med taxaservices, cykeludlejningsfirmaer, løbehjulsudlejningsfirmaer, restauranter og meget mere.

Sådan tjener du penge

En så stor mængde funktioner kræver en stor udviklingsindsats, men det kommer vi til at tale om lidt senere.

Lad os nu se, hvordan man kan tjene penge på sådanne applikationer til booking af indkvartering.

Servicegebyrer

Vi har allerede nævnt ovenfor, at produkter som Air Bed and Breakfast opkræver en vis procentdel af transaktionen som servicegebyr fra både værter og besøgende.

Selv om det ser uretfærdigt ud, er begge brugertyper villige til at betale sådanne provisioner, da produktet ikke opkræver overraskende beløb for hjælp til booking og samtidig holder tingene enkle og effektive. Desuden er alle gebyrer fra den besøgendes side normalt inkluderet i overnatningsomkostningerne.

Reklamer

Applikationen kan også drage fordel af at placere annoncer i brugergrænsefladen. Hvis de ikke er forstyrrende og ubrugelige, vil de fleste brugere være villige til at se dem for at få en relativt billig, men god service.

Sådanne annoncer kan simpelthen være målrettede reklamer eller mere komplicerede anbefalinger af nogle lokale virksomheder afhængigt af brugerens destination.

Også promoverede lister, der viser bestemte lejligheder frem for andre, kan være relateret til annoncer.

Sikkerhedsstillelse

Ved at oprette interne teams eller samarbejde med lokale tjenester kan en rejsebestillingsapp også tjene penge.

Det kan omfatte alt fra taxaservice til professionel fotografering for bedre lejlighedspromovering eller rengøringsservice.

udvikle Airbnb

Udvikling af appen

Det er i sidste ende det punkt, hvor du klart skal forstå, om du vil vælge udvikling af rejseapps eller ej.

Lad os dykke ned i, hvad der er brug for til airbnb-lignende app-udvikling.

Teknisk stak

De teknologier, der bruges til udvikling og vedligeholdelse af Airbnb, er ingen hemmelighed. De er gemt i offentlige GitHub-arkiver og stackshare.

Som vi kan se, er der mange forskellige teknologier og værktøjer. Lad os pege på de vigtigste.

  • Air Bed and Breakfast er bygget på Ruby on Rails Rammeværk
  • Den bruger hovedsageligt Ruby og ReactJS programmeringssprog
  • Webserveren drives af Nginx
  • Cloud-teknologier omfatter Amazon S3, EBS, RDS, EC2, og Redis
  • Blandt datastyringsværktøjer kan vi fremhæve Hadoop, Airflow, Presto, Druid, Airpal

Disse teknologier vil være nok til at skabe en MVP af produktet. Der vil være brug for flere mobiludviklere (Android og iOS) bagefter, eller de kan erstattes af et team af Flutter-udviklere for at reducere omkostningerne til udvikling af mobilapps til rejser betydeligt.

Teamets sammensætning

At udvikle en Airbnb-lignende applikation er en kompleks opgave, der kræver en omfattende tilgang.

Som en Firma til udvikling af rejseapps med stor erfaring, foreslår vi at have et team på mindst

  • 1 forretningsanalytiker
  • 1 projektleder
  • 1 UI/UX-designer
  • 1 eller 2 Android-udviklere
  • 1 eller 2 iOS-udviklere
  • 2 back-end-udviklere
  • 1 Data Engineer
  • 1 eller 2 front-end-udviklere
  • 1 DevOps Engineer
  • 1 QA Engineer
  • 1 Automation QA Engineer

For at reducere projektomkostningerne og øge udviklingshastigheden kan du erstatte Android-, iOS- og frontend-udviklere med et team på 3 eller 4 Flutter-udviklere, der bygger en applikation på tværs af platforme.

Omkostninger

Lad os antage, at projektteamet består af de specialister, der er nævnt ovenfor.

Hvis vi tjekker de gennemsnitlige priser i USA og antager, at MVP vil være færdig på omkring to måneder, ser vi følgende billede:

  • UI/UX-design vil koste omkring $13,000;
  • Backend-udvikling vil koste omkring $25,000;
  • mobilapplikationer (iOS og Android) vil tage omkring $43,000;
  • webapplikation vil koste omkring $20,000;
  • Du får brug for $14,000 til kvalitetssikring;
  • datateknik vil trække en anden $21,000 fra budgettet;
  • operationelle enheder som projektledelse og forretningsanalyse vil koste omkring $27,000.

Så de samlede omkostninger til MVP-udvikling for en sådan applikation i USA vil være $163,000. Vi kan erstatte web- og mobiludviklere med Flutter-udviklere for at reducere nogle omkostninger og vil modtage de endelige omkostninger på $120,000.

Ved at vælge en leverandør af softwareudviklingstjenester fra Østeuropa får virksomheder gavn af at modtage tjenester i verdensklasse til mere rimelige priser. I gennemsnit reduceres udgifterne med ca. 17-20%. Så den helt oprindelige udvikling, der udføres af en softwareudviklingsvirksomhed fra Østeuropa, vil koste omkring $134,000, og den Flutter-baserede cross-platform-version vil koste $100.000 dollars.

Du kan kontakte os, hvis du ønsker at skabe en lokal applikation, der kan erstatte Airbnb i din region. Vi dykker dybt ned i din projektidé, analyserer den og giver dig et præcist estimat af udvikling af rejseapps tid og omkostninger.

OFTE STILLEDE SPØRGSMÅL

Det første skridt er at gennemføre en grundig markedsundersøgelse for at forstå brugernes behov, præferencer og konkurrencen i rejse- og hotelbranchen.

Implementer robuste sikkerhedsforanstaltninger som datakryptering, sikker autentificering, regelmæssige sikkerhedsrevisioner og overholdelse af databeskyttelsesbestemmelser som GDPR.

Væsentlige funktioner omfatter brugerprofiler, ejendomsfortegnelser, booking- og betalingssystemer, beskeder, anmeldelser og en søge-/filterfunktion.

Ja, kundesupport er afgørende. Du kan tilbyde chat-support i appen, en vidensbase og et dedikeret supportteam til at hjælpe brugerne.

Udnyt digital markedsføring, annoncering på sociale medier, SEO og partnerskaber med influencere eller rejsebloggere til at promovere din app effektivt.

Tidslinjen kan variere, men det tager ofte flere måneder til et år eller mere, afhængigt af appens kompleksitet og teamets størrelse.

Eksempler er Vrbo, Booking.com, HomeAway og TripAdvisor.
Husk, at udviklingsprocessen kan være kompleks, så det er vigtigt at planlægge grundigt og søge ekspertrådgivning, når det er nødvendigt.

Indholdsfortegnelse

    Kontakt os

    Book et opkald eller udfyld formularen nedenfor, så vender vi tilbage til dig, når vi har behandlet din anmodning.

    Send os en talebesked
    Vedhæft dokumenter
    Upload fil

    Du kan vedhæfte 1 fil på op til 2 MB. Gyldige filformater: pdf, jpg, jpeg, png.

    Ved at klikke på Send accepterer du, at Innowise behandler dine personlige data i henhold til vores Politik for beskyttelse af personlige oplysninger for at give dig relevante oplysninger. Ved at indsende dit telefonnummer accepterer du, at vi kan kontakte dig via taleopkald, sms og beskedapps. Opkalds-, besked- og datatakster kan være gældende.

    Du kan også sende os din anmodning
    til contact@innowise.com

    Hvad sker der nu?

    1

    Når vi har modtaget og behandlet din anmodning, vender vi tilbage til dig for at beskrive dine projektbehov og underskriver en NDA for at sikre fortrolighed.

    2

    Når vi har undersøgt dine ønsker, behov og forventninger, udarbejder vores team et projektforslag med forslag med arbejdets omfang, teamstørrelse, tids- og omkostningsoverslag.

    3

    Vi arrangerer et møde med dig for at diskutere tilbuddet og få detaljerne på plads.

    4

    Til sidst underskriver vi en kontrakt og begynder at arbejde på dit projekt med det samme.

    pil